In the interview Louise talks about the power of affirmations and how much they can support a person in making changes in their life. Recently I have been told that affirmations don't work because they conflict with your logical mind and actually can cause just the opposite of what you want to happen. First with affirmations you are not talking to your logical mind, which in my opinion will get you in more trouble than you can imagine, you are talking to your subconscious. That is the part of your mind that takes whatever you tell it and works to make it true. Maybe you can't tell yourself far out things like "I am going to build a set of wings and fly to the moon" however some people think telling themselves "I am capable of taking care of myself" is just as far out. The idea here is to feed yourself positive thoughts so that eventually you can believe them.

I went through a period of time when I was being stalked. I found myself being frightened even when I couldn't see any danger around me. I could simply feel it. I started saying the affirmation, "I am safe wherever I am and whoever I am with." I used this affirmation for years and it worked to calm me down and allowed me not to live in fear. Although I no longer feel a sense of fear every once in a while I have a sense of not feeling safe and I use that affirmation. For me it is better than any drug I could take. It works like a charm.

Affirmations are the prelude to taking action. They will support you in getting into action. You first have to be able to conceive a concept, to think it in your mind. Once you are able to do that you can create an affirmation that will support you in believing what you are thinking. When you create an affirmation and begin to repeat it you are planting seeds and drawing what you want to you. This is The Law of Attraction at it's best. However once you draw what you want to you it is time for action. I call this inspired action and it is the key to The Law of Action, the Law that makes the Law of Attraction work. You might get an intuitive hit to call a friend or go a certain way home from work or read a certain book. Then what happens is your friend gives you a piece of information your were looking for, or you come across something you needed to see on your way home or the book is just the resource you needed.

According to Louise Hay "Everything you think and say is an affirmation." I so believe that. My mother lived in fear of dying of cancer and she thought about it and talked about it for years. I bet you can guess what my Mother died from.

If you want to tap into the power of your mind and use it to create what you want in your life and not just accept what you create by default, begin using the power of affirmations. If your not sure how to create an affirmation visit Louise Hay's website, she provides a new affirmation every day.
